analyzing regression results
latasha was presented with the following data set and argued that there was no correlation between x and y. is latasha correct? use the regression equation to explain your reasoning
x 1 2 3 4 5 6 7
y 4 5 4 5 4 5 4

Explanation:

Step1: Calculate means of x and y

$\bar{x} = \frac{1+2+3+4+5+6+7}{7} = 4$, $\bar{y} = \frac{4+5+4+5+4+5+4}{7} \approx 4.4286$

Step2: Compute slope of regression line

$b_1 = \frac{n\sum(xy)-(\sum x)(\sum y)}{n\sum x^2-(\sum x)^2}$. $\sum(xy)=124$, $n\sum(xy)=7*124=868$, $(\sum x)(\sum y)=28*31=868$. Numerator=0, so $b_1=0$.

Answer:

LaTasha is correct. The regression slope is 0, indicating no linear correlation between x and y.
